Output 12580a362996c5bc508c849ca9c3ad018c6170d8edfa6815b98c4265fb85bd59:0

value
697705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c22e33aa89faffd1dfb0c0a3ff393c9bd145a119 OP_EQUAL
address
3KPkMvBExZJX8b4YVBkWTcuAj3QbRswJbi
transaction
12580a362996c5bc508c849ca9c3ad018c6170d8edfa6815b98c4265fb85bd59
spent
true